Handover for night shift — Orbin Media studio, level 3. The training-video recording wrapped at 18:40; cameras are locked in the equipment cage and the teleprompter is charging. Cleaners are due around 23:00, so leave the lighting rig untouched until they finish. The studio stays alarmed overnight, and the door-pass code is noted below.

turnstile pass: bdg-QZV-3

Ticket PLUG-2214: Expired creds breaking compaction hooks

Hey plugin folks — if your Driftmill compaction hooks started failing overnight with 401s, that's on us. The service credential your plugins use to call the compaction-status endpoint expired Tuesday and nobody caught it. Oops. We've minted a replacement with a proper expiry alert this time. Swap it into your plugin config and re-run any stalled compaction jobs. The new key for the Driftmill internal API is just below.

gateway credential: kto23_LX9A4ys6i4nzHtpOLNLodKK

// Broker upgrade notes for plugin authors:
// Quillbus 4.x replaces the legacy 3.x wire protocol. Plugins must
// construct the client with explicit protocol negotiation enabled,
// or connections to the Larkfield cluster will be silently downgraded
// and dropped after 30s. Topic names are unchanged. For local testing
// against the sandbox broker, authenticate with the key below.

API key for bafof-bagaf: qvz2-qi